by Jenni Blackmore (Author), Jenni Blackmore (Illustrator)

"Your 'one stop shop' for everything from seed to plate . . . This book will leave you . . . ready to launch your own journey to food self-sufficiency." --Lisa Kivirist, author Soil Sisters

Put off by the origin-unknown, not-so-fresh, pesticide-laden herbs at the grocery store? Hungry for delicious high-quality vegetables and looking to have some control over where your food comes from?

Foodie meets novice gardener in this deliciously accessible, easy-to-use guide to planting, growing, harvesting, cooking, and preserving 20+ popular, easy-to-grow vegetables and herbs. Taking the first-time gardener from growing to cooking delicious, nutritious, and affordable meals using these herbs and vegetables, this book is a celebration of food in all its stages.

The Food Lover's Garden guides you through:

  • Getting started with easy step-by-step growing instructions from balcony to backyard
  • Simple, tasty cooking recipes incorporating each vegetable and herb
  • Meal combinations of two or more of the featured herb and vegetable dishes
  • Selecting essential kitchen tools and gadgets to maximize the herb and vegetable harvesting
  • Canning and pickling recipes for preserving the rest.

From the humble potato to pungent garlic to the beauty of the beet, classic vegetables take a delicious turn with innovative cooking recipes. Truly food for all seasons and palates.

Foodies, novice gardeners, urban homesteaders, and supporters of sustainable living--take back your right to high-quality food with The Food Lover's Garden.

JENNI BLACKMORE is a writer, painter, micro-farmer, and certified Permaculture Design Consultant. Her most recent book, Permaculture for the Rest of Us , follows her journey from industrial Manchester to Quackadoodle Farm, a sustainable homestead in Nova Scotia.

Author Biography

Jenni Blackmore is a farmer, artist and writer who built her house on a rocky, windswept island off the coast of Nova Scotia almost twenty-five years ago and has been stumbling along the road to self-sufficient living ever since.
